Why compress a pin at all

Pinterest re-encodes what you upload, so compression will not change how the pin looks in the feed. The benefit is everywhere else: faster uploads, less storage, and — if you use the same image on your blog — a materially faster page.

That last one matters most. The image on your destination page is usually the heaviest thing on it, and page speed affects both how Google ranks the page and how many Pinterest visitors stay long enough to read it. A pin that sends traffic to a slow page wastes the traffic.

Picking a quality level

QualityResult
90–95%Effectively lossless. Modest size reduction.
75–85%The sweet spot. Usually indistinguishable, often 50–70% smaller.
60–70%Slight softening in flat areas. Fine for photos, less so for text.
Below 60%Visible artefacts, especially around text and sharp edges.

Start at 75% and look at the preview. If the image is mostly photographic you can usually go lower; if it carries fine text or hard-edged graphics, stay higher — JPEG handles sharp edges worst.

A note on formats

Output is JPEG, which is the right default for photographic pins and universally supported. If your image is a graphic with flat colour and crisp text, PNG or WebP may preserve it better at a similar size — in that case compress it with a format-aware tool rather than this one.

Choosing a quality setting

JPEG quality is not linear. The jump from 100% to about 85% removes a large amount of file weight and almost no visible detail; below about 70% artefacts start showing on gradients and edges.

  • Photographs: 80–85% is the sweet spot. At pin display sizes it is indistinguishable from full quality.
  • Images with text overlay: stay higher, around 90%, or use PNG. JPEG compression attacks hard edges, and type is all hard edges.
  • Flat graphics and illustrations: PNG. It compresses large areas of solid colour losslessly and usually produces a smaller file than JPEG for that kind of image.

Format, briefly

  • JPEG — photographs. Small files, lossy, poor with sharp edges and text.
  • PNG — graphics, text, anything needing transparency. Lossless, larger for photos.
  • WebP — smaller than both at similar quality and excellent on your own website. Support for uploading it varies by platform, so keep a JPEG or PNG for the pin itself.

Compression that hurts

Every lossy save is a generation loss, and they stack. An image exported at 70%, edited, and exported at 70% again is not at 70% — it is visibly worse than either step suggests.

So compress once, at the end. Keep your working file at full quality, do all your edits there, and export the compressed version last. If you need to revise, go back to the original rather than re-editing the compressed copy.

What compression cannot fix

A soft image compresses badly and stays soft. Compression removes information; it never adds sharpness. If a pin looks blurry, the problem is upstream — an upscaled source, a screenshot, or a low-resolution original. Fix it at the source with a larger file, or crop tighter rather than scaling up.
